Cohere

Cohere Inc. is a Canadian multinational technology company that develops large language models and artificial intelligence products for enterprise applications. The company specializes in serving regulated industries, including finance, healthcare, manufacturing, and energy, as well as the public sector. Founded in 2019 by Aidan Gomez, Ivan Zhang, and Nick Frosst, the company is headquartered in Toronto and San Francisco with several international offices. A notable initiative is Cohere Labs, a nonprofit research lab dedicated to open-source machine learning research. The company's platform is powered by infrastructure from Google Cloud, which utilizes its Tensor Processing Units (TPUs). Cohere is currently led by CEO Aidan Gomez and President and COO Martin Kon.

RoboFlow

Roboflow is a software development company that provides a computer vision platform for developers. The company's core product is an end-to-end solution that enables users to manage image datasets, train computer vision models, and deploy them into applications. Its platform includes an open source repository containing over 500,000 labeled datasets and 500 million images. Founded in 2019 by Brad Dwyer and Joseph Nelson, the company has raised $63.4 million in funding and has been used by over one million developers. Recent developments include the integration of models like Gemini 3 Pro for auto-labeling datasets.
